> > Whoops!  In the previous posting I indicated that the programs
> > were run with STDIN = /dev/null. I meant to say STDIN = printing
> > device...
>
> Can you elaborate on this?  Do you pass a socket or file descriptor to the 
> printer connection to STDIN?  Or do you pass contents of ":lp="?
>
> If you try to pass in an open connection, the latest Xerox/Tek printers are 
> not going to work.  You can't old any open TCP connections to them and expect 
> the status of the current job (as reported by SNMP) to ever report "completed" 
> (or will the pagecounter increment).

If you look at the ifhp code, you will discover the connections are CLOSED
and then REOPENED before being passeed to the programs.

This handles the problem.

Had to think about this one and then test it.
